Releases: Alireza-Moh/whisperer_for_laravel
Releases · Alireza-Moh/whisperer_for_laravel
v1.2.1
v1.2.0
- - Adds keyboard shortcut for the search menu.
- - Adds Inertia page creation action.
- - Adds Inertia page inspection check.
- - Adds route action 'Go to Declaration' support for older Laravel versions.
- - Fixes bugs.
- - Minimum required version set to PhpStorm 2024.1, dropping support for 2023 and below.
v1.1.6
- Bug fix: Validates Laravel framework installation based on the specified version
- Code cleanup
- Removes unused libraries
- Ensures Laravel version extraction runs within a read action for improved thread safety
v1.1.5
- Changes plugin icon
- Adds java docs
- Removes unused libraries
- Restructures project packages
v1.1.4
- Adds support for accessing request fields via a new request methods [input(), string(), integer(), boolean(), float()]
- Improves support for additional form request field access patterns
- Searches for table names in models
- Fixes some bugs
v1.1.3
- Adds new code-generation actions: json-resource, json-resource-collection, form-request, eloquent-scope, eloquent-cast, broadcasting-channel, db-factory, view-composer
- Adds navigation link to the plugin settings in the tool menu.
- Adds env values completion.
- Adds support for
withoutMiddleware()
- Adds indexing for config keys and blade files
- Fixes some bugs.
v1.1.2
- Adds autocompletion for controller actions and namespaces in route definitions
- Adds middleware autocompletion.
- Fixes bugs.
v1.1.1
- Triggers route names autocompletion for Redirect::route(), Redirect::signedRoute(), URL::route(), and URL::signedRoute() methods.
- Suppresses "Property accessed via magic method" warning for request fields.
- Adds request fields autocompletion and resolving.
- Implements method to resolve validation rules.
- Generates Eloquent models based on their namespace.
- Fixes Inertia.js autocompletion to include pages located directly in the root folder.
- Provides autocompletion for migration files and resolves related table files globally.
v1.1.0
Changes:
- Added setting option for module src folder and Laravel directory
- Added view mailable action
- Added check for Laravel root directory when the default is overwritten
- Improved resolving and completion for configs, gates, routes, blade views
- Added Inertia pages completion and resolving
- Added feature to provide controller method usage in routes